The Local Development
Framework replaces the Local Plan (Second Review). Consultation
only runs until 31 March 2008 and is based on a questionnaire
for us to complete in the LDF Core Strategy document.
The Core
Strategy sets out the overall planning framework for the
district. All other Local Development Framework policy documents
will build on the principles in it and need to comply with it.
It looks ahead up to 2026. |

This
EHDC CORE STRATEGY ISSUES & OPTIONS DOCUMENT
describes what EHDC have to deliver in terms of housing to meet
Government targets and a range of options & processes available.
It
is vital we communicate our views both as F4FM and as
individuals before 31 March 2008. The options cover different
balances between allocated and 'windfall' sites (the ones we
often object to). It is far more difficult to object to
pre-allocated sites !
